引言在数字化时代,自动化操作已经成为提高工作效率的重要手段。Python作为一种功能强大的编程语言,在自动化领域有着广泛的应用。本文将深入探讨如何使用Python在锁屏状态下控制鼠标,实现高效的自动化...
在数字化时代,自动化操作已经成为提高工作效率的重要手段。Python作为一种功能强大的编程语言,在自动化领域有着广泛的应用。本文将深入探讨如何使用Python在锁屏状态下控制鼠标,实现高效的自动化操作。
Python自动化操作主要依赖于第三方库,如PyAutoGUI和pynput等。这些库能够模拟用户的鼠标和键盘操作,从而实现自动化任务。
PyAutoGUI是一个用于进行屏幕操作的Python库,它可以模拟鼠标移动、点击,键盘输入等操作。PyAutoGUI支持Windows、macOS和Linux系统,是自动化操作中常用的工具。
pynput是一个用于控制和监控鼠标和键盘的Python库。它提供了简单易用的接口,使开发者可以轻松地模拟各种鼠标和键盘操作,并监听这些操作的事件。
在锁屏状态下控制鼠标,需要借助第三方库和系统功能。以下将详细介绍如何实现这一功能。
pip install pyautogui import pyautogui # 移动鼠标到屏幕中心 pyautogui.moveTo(500, 500) # 点击鼠标左键 pyautogui.click() # 模拟键盘输入 pyautogui.typewrite('Hello, World!') # 截图 pyautogui.screenshot('screenshot.png')设置计划任务
pip install pynput from pynput.mouse import Controller # 实例化鼠标控制器 mouse = Controller() # 移动鼠标到屏幕中心 mouse.position = (500, 500) # 点击鼠标左键 mouse.click() # 模拟键盘输入 from pynput.keyboard import Controller as KeyboardController keyboard = KeyboardController() keyboard.type('Hello, World!')设置系统权限
优化脚本性能
使用注释和文档
测试和调试
掌握Python控制锁屏下鼠标,可以帮助我们实现高效的自动化操作,提高工作效率。通过使用PyAutoGUI和pynput等库,我们可以轻松地控制鼠标和键盘,实现各种自动化任务。在实际应用中,注意优化脚本性能、编写注释和文档,以及进行充分的测试和调试,以确保自动化脚本的稳定运行。